Insider Selling Trends: State Street Corporation insiders have sold more shares than they bought over the past year, with significant sales including a $1.9 million transaction by Patrick de Saint-Aignan, raising concerns among shareholders about potential implications for the company's future.
Insider Ownership and Earnings Growth: Despite the selling activity, insider ownership stands at 0.6%, valued at approximately $177 million, which suggests alignment of management incentives with shareholder interests; however, the lack of recent purchases and ongoing insider selling warrants caution.

About STT
State Street Corporation is a financial holding company. The Company, through its subsidiary, State Street Bank and Trust Company (State Street Bank), provides a range of financial products and services to institutional investors. It operates through two lines of business: Investment Servicing and Investment Management. Its Investment Servicing line of business provides a range of services and market and financing solutions to institutional clients, including mutual funds, collective investment funds and other investment pools, corporate and public retirement plans, insurance companies, investment managers, foundations and endowments worldwide. Through State Street Investment Services, State Street Markets and State Street Alpha, it offers a range of solutions, including transaction management, derivatives, collateral services, and others. Investment Management line of business provides a range of investment management solutions and products through State Street Investment Management.
